Title :
Design of Health Relaxation System Based on Biofeedback from Finger Sensors

Abstract :
With the rapid development of sensor and computer technologies, many human health measurement instrument and software based on variable kinds of sensors are emerging. But most of them are just belonged to positive measurement tools and can´t instruct user to relax their emotion. In this paper, we present a health relaxation system which can collect information from human body using our sensor and teach user how to relax using biofeedback information from the sensor.
